Midtown overview
Yonge-Eglinton works well for people who want massage options near transit, offices, condos, and Midtown errands. The area has a mix of clinics, spas, and wellness providers, so the important step is narrowing by service type rather than treating every listing as interchangeable.

Getting there
Transit access is usually the area advantage, while parking can depend heavily on the exact building or side street. Check the business source for entrance, parking, elevator, and appointment instructions.

Frequently asked questions
Is Yonge–Eglinton walkable?
Many Midtown options are walkable from the station area, but construction, weather, and building access can affect the trip. Confirm the exact address and entrance before heading out.
Where should first-timers go?
First-timers should choose a business with clear service descriptions, direct contact details, and enough published information to understand the appointment style.
